#9983d6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9983d6 is composed of 60% red, 51.4%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.5% cyan, 38.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 255.9 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 67.6%. #9983d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3307ad.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#9983d6 color description : Slightly desaturated violet.

#9983d6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9983d6 has RGB values of R:153, G:131,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 10060758.

Shades and Tints of #9983d6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040309 is the darkest color, while #faf9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9983d6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aba9b0 is the less saturated color, while #875dfc is the most saturated one.
